Comprehensive Summarization:

The article reports on a sudden and significant downturn in the US travel sector, with major companies such as Airbnb, Delta, Expedia, and Booking Holdings experiencing sharp declines in their stock prices. This downturn is attributed to a sharp decline in American tourism, which is currently in a severe state of decline. The article highlights the crisis faced by these industry giants, emphasizing the dramatic impact on the US tourism industry and the future outlook for these companies. The situation is described as unprecedented, with the world watching as the US tourism decline deepens.

Key Points:

  1. The US travel sector is experiencing a sudden and severe meltdown in stock prices for major companies including Airbnb, Delta, Expedia, and Booking Holdings.
  2. The decline in American tourism is the primary driver behind the sudden downturn in these companies’ stock prices.
  3. The crisis faced by these industry leaders is unprecedented, signaling a deepening crisis in the US tourism industry.
